Released in 1941, La quinta calumnia is a comedy film directed by Adelqui Migliar, running about 78 minutes.
What it’s about. A huge store in Buenos Aires is about to close due to restrictions on imports. The owner of the store returns from a vacation in France, and knowing the financial situation proceeds to throw a big gala party. He hires a man he had met abroad to pose as a fake earl, hoping to attract wealthy clients.
Who’s in it. La quinta calumnia stars Alí Salem de Baraja, Alberto Anchart, Vicente Climent and Alberto Terrones, among others.
